Question:
Can anyone confirm whether the R1 versions of the Bond DVDs have the same animated menus (and general look and feel) as the R2 versions?
I'm thinking of getting the uncut R1 versions of GoldenEye and Tomorrow Never Dies, but don't want to lose the cool animated menus and music.

I can confirm that the 'uncut' (they still have one or two edits) GoldenEye and the uncut Tomorrow Never Dies has the very cool menus in R1.

I have a couple of the R1s and their menus are actually slightly better IMO in that they are accompanied by a line of dialogue from the movie in question. The For Your Eyes Only one has Bond saying "a feast for my eyes". A nice touch missing from the R2s.
